Steve began his law
enforcement career in 1974. Over the next 15 years, he served in
various functional capacities with both municipal and county police
agencies. From 1978 until his retirement in 1989, Steve was a
Deputy Sheriff in Livingston County, Michigan. As a Deputy, he
spent several years working as a patrol officer, and was promoted to
Sergeant in 1982. Following a three year assignment as commander of
the afternoon shift, Steve was appointed to the newly created
position of Staff Services Administrator, where he had primary
responsibility for the administrative support functions of the
department, including research and development of all departmental
policies, development and presentation of training programs,
management of the department’s training effort, supervision of the
department's community service programs, and coordination of the
department's Emergency Management function. He also served as Chief
Instructor and department Armorer.
Steve is a certified
instructor in many police subjects, including firearms, driving,
radar, chemical munitions, TASER and defensive tactics, and has
attended over 5,700 hours of advanced police training. He has
served as an adjunct faculty member at several Michigan colleges,
and at the Smith and Wesson Academy. Prior to his retirement in
2007, he was the Chief Driving and Firearms Instructor for the
Washtenaw Police Academy, in Ann Arbor, Michigan. He has been a
police trainer since 1975, and continues to develop and present
training programs on a regular basis. Steve attended Michigan State
University where he received his Bachelor's and Master's Degrees,
and Eastern Michigan University, where he earned a second Master’s
Degree. Steve also attended Northwestern University's Traffic
Institute, where he completed The School of Police Staff and
Command. He is a multi-session graduate of the Smith & Wesson
Academy (where he earned the designation Master Force & Control
Instructor), and of the prestigious Federal Law Enforcement Training
Center. Steve is a TASER Senior Master Instructor, a Master
Instructor for TSA Baggage Screener Training, and holds a Master Use
of Force Instructor certification from the Police Policy Studies
Council.
Steve is also certified as a Force Science Analyst by the Force
Science Institute.
Steve has worked as a law
enforcement expert witness since 1995, consulting on over 120 cases,
and testifying in many. He specializes in use of force, motor
vehicle operation, arrest practices and police & corrections
procedural issues.
Steve has been an invited
staff member at many training and management conferences, including
those sponsored by the National League of Cities, the American
Society of Law Enforcement Trainers (ASLET), the Public Risk
Management Association (PRIMA), the International Association of
Chiefs of Police (IACP), PPCT Management Systems, the International
Law Enforcement Educators and Trainers Association (ILEETA), the
Association of Emergency Vehicle Response Trainers (ALERT,
International) and numerous State Chief’s and Sheriff’s
Associations. Steve is a prolific author, and is recognized
nationally as an authority in risk management and its application to
the use of force/control and vehicle operations.
Steve is a member of the
Advisory Board of ILEETA, and formerly served as Michigan State
Director and Region Five Director for ASLET. Steve is an active
member of ALERT International, the International Association of Law
Enforcement Firearms Instructors (IALEFI), Phi Kappa Phi, Alpha Phi
Sigma and American MENSA, and is a lifetime member of the Police
Marksman Association.
Steve has published many
articles on the use of force and control, police driving, and the
management of risk in criminal justice operations, as well as police
training and training management. He has been the regular computer
columnist for Police and Security News, and has been a monthly
contributor to the on-line magazine Officer.com, as well as the
Training Columnist for the on-line magazine PoliceMag.com. Steve
designs websites, and also volunteers his time as the Webmaster for
ILEETA.
Before becoming an
independent risk management and training consultant, Steve served as
a Risk Control Manager and Director of Law Enforcement Risk Control
for American Risk Pooling Consultants of Southfield, Michigan. Steve
also served as Public Entity Loss Control Manager and Director of
Law Enforcement Risk Control for Meadowbrook Insurance Group of
Southfield. Prior to that, Steve worked as a Risk Control
Consultant, and as Manager of the Risk Control Department, for
another large municipal property and casualty pool. During his
tenure there, he earned the designations Associate in Risk
Management and Associate in Risk Management – Public Entities from
the Insurance Institute of America.
